What is the ÖSD B2 Certification?
The ÖSD (Österreichisches Sprachdiplom deutsch zertifikat) B2 certification is an official language credentials that examines intermediate proficiency in the German language. It is particularly recognized in Austria, Germany, and Switzerland, making it a valuable property for those planning to study or work in these countries.
At the B2 level, students are expected to:
Comprehend the essences of intricate texts on both concrete and abstract subjects.
Connect with fluency and spontaneity with native speakers.
Produce clear, in-depth texts on a wide range of topics related to their interests.

Structure of the ÖSD B2 Exam
The ÖSD B2 examination consists of four primary components: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king. Each section assesses various competencies within the language ability set.
1. Listening Comprehension
In this section, test-takers listen to different audio clips such as discussions, report, sprachtest and conversations. They are required to answer questions that measure their understanding of content, tone, and ramifications.
2. Reading Comprehension
This part consists of different written products like posts, advertisements, and emails. Candidates need to show their ability to understand the context and key concepts, as well as analyze various kinds of texts.
3. Writing
Candidates are asked to write a text based on a particular subject, typically requiring structured arguments and coherent thinking. This could consist of composing essays, reports, or formal letters.
4. Speaking
The speaking examination typically includes two parts: a monologue and a dialogue with an inspector. Test-takers need to communicate efficiently, sprachtest express opinions, and react to concerns clearly.
Scoring System
Each element is scored separately, and to pass, prospects normally need to attain an average rating across all sections. The grading criteria concentrate on language efficiency, coherence, fluency, and the ability to participate in dialogue.
